I have seen it 3 times, in addition to what has been reported on this forum over the years.
All were early C5 models.
All dropped the exhaust valve head.
Two of them we repaired the heavy damage to the heads, and the customers rebuilt the bottom.
One of them is a warranty engine that I got during a clearance sale. It suffered this kind of damage during warranty, and they replaced it. I use it as a parts engine, and for reference.
The two we fixed had been ridden on the highway for all day in hot weather. I don't know the circumstances that killed the warranty engine I got.
Seeing you are from Australia, you should know that Australia is known for killing Bullets. Apparently there is a lot of hot weather and people get on the highways and drive at fairly high speed for long periods. The old iron barrel Bullets couldn't take this, and dropped like flies. The UCE does a little better.
